Institutional Accreditation Officer- Job Grade Cue 6 at Commission for University Education

Commission for University Education logo

  • Duties and responsibilities at this level will entail: –

Providing administrative and logistical arrangements for routine inspection/technical Inspection Committee meetings;

Organizing documentation for Accreditation Committee Meetings;

In-putting data on proposals received, institutions being evaluated and accredited institutions;

In-putting data on prequalified peer reviewers into the official departmental database;

Writing minutes during departmental and lower-level Commission Committee Meetings;

Evaluating proposals on proposed universities and preparing evaluation reports;

Evaluating institutional reports; and

Maintaining status reports on the evaluation of the academic programmes.

Person specification

  • For appointment to this grade, an officer must have: –

  • Bachelors Degree in any of the following disciplines: – Education, Business Administration, Law, Social Sciences or any other relevant qualification from a recognized institution;

Membership to relevant professional bodies and in good standing;

Proficiency in computer applications; and

Fulfilled the requirements of Chapter Six of the Constitution of Kenya.

Key competencies and skills

Communication and reporting skills;

Analytical skills;

Interpersonal skill; and

Negotiation skills.

The Successful candidates will be required to provide the following documents before the award of offer in compliance with Chapter 6 of the Constitution of Kenya, 2010:

  • Valid Certificate of Good Conduct from the Directorate of Criminal Investigations (DCI).

  • Clearance from the Ethics and Anti-Corruption Commission (EACC).

  • Tax Compliance Certificate from Kenya Revenue Authority (KRA).

  • Clearance Certificate from the Higher Education Loans Board (HELB).

  • Clearance Certificate from an approved Credit Reference Bureau (CRB).
